Output 249521c1e58e9bca157dcfb9e203a09d98fedd8b3f3a54c6df1d2cf8a3457890:1

value
3293903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badba433a40480c103cfaa83c0cc846e0e5a061 OP_EQUAL
address
3QdmeVpKGeiUE8FMYXFgRHrp5666hNKKQx
transaction
249521c1e58e9bca157dcfb9e203a09d98fedd8b3f3a54c6df1d2cf8a3457890
spent
true